A home's rain gutter system is made to safeguard the roof, siding, and also foundation from water damage as well as the build-up of mold, mildew, as well as pests that like to nest in these moist conditions. However, the horizontal rain gutter trough is prone to collecting dirt, animal feces, leaves, sticks, and also various other particles, which can lead to the whole system to block.
Rain gutter cleaning can make a great DIY project, but only if you're comfortable as well as have stable a foot-hold on a high ladder bring 2 containers, one for particles, as well as the other for your tools. Outsourcing the task to an expert can stop injuries from falls as well as enable the gutter cleaning professional to check for any type of drainage and also rain gutter wear problems.

Rain gutters are developed to capture water and also disperse it far (an advised 6 to 10 feet away) from your house's exterior siding as well as foundation. In time, gutters end up being obstructed with particles-- loosened branches, birds' nests, dropped nuts, and various other sediment. If rain gutters aren't cleaned, they won't be able to properly transfer water from your roof to the external sides of your house's structure, triggering water to pool on your roof, near your residence, or in gutters themselves. This standing water welcomes a variety of threats, including mold and mildew on your roof as well as in your wall surfaces, leaky and also fallen gutters, a split foundation, and also an oversaturated lawn that welcomes weeds, pests, and also other bugs.
When house owners have water troubles and also need to have their walls as well as ceiling fixed, bad gutters are generally the factor. Shielding your gutters with rain gutters guards are a necessity to stop your residence from water problems. Excessive weight from particles, ice and also snow causes the gutters guiding away from the fascia board and likewise causes them to sag and also split.
Higher toward the roof, clogged up rain gutters can result in rotten fascia boards as well as feasible damage to indoor wall surfaces and ceilings. During a rainstorm, a normal household roof will certainly need to get rid of hundreds, if not countless gallons of water. In damp areas of the nation rain gutters are mandatory to funnel roof overflow securely away from the home. Given that the majority of houses have basements, falling short to channel water far from the dirt right away adjacent to the house's foundation is a practically particular invite to a wide variety of basement moisture-related troubles. Consequently, a properly functioning rain gutter system is not only crucial for protecting against damage to the lower section of the roof, fascia as well as soffit components, yet avoiding various other expensive home repair work.
